The new Intensive & Assertive Service being developed by NSFT is a trust wide model designed to support people with serious mental illness (SMI), particularly those with psychosis, who struggle to engage with traditional services and therefore face heightened risks and poorer outcomes. It offers proactive, flexible, and highly responsive care with small caseloads, frequent (potentially daily) contact, and extended hours. The service operates as a hub and spoke model across Norfolk and Suffolk, with central oversight of the full cohort (approximately 200 Service Users at any one time) and the ability to step people up or down depending on need. Its core functions include intensive care coordination, risk assessment and management, relapse prevention, and consultation, all with a strong emphasis on continuity of care and multi agency collaboration. A defining feature of the model is its collaboration with Sub-Contractors, which will deliver a significant proportion of the frontline engagement and recovery support. While NSFT provides clinical leadership, including medical oversight, use of legal frameworks, and complex risk management; Sub-contractors will supply recovery workers focussed on Recovery and Outreach, enabling more flexible, community based engagement with individuals. The recovery workers will deliver services 7 days per week, working flexibly between 9am and 7pm: - delivering assertive outreach - offering practical support such as help with housing, finances and daily living, - supporting community participation and social inclusion, - supporting access to healthcare, - providing non-clinical medication support, - offering substance misuse and harm reduction support - whilst also providing carer and family support - contributing to risk management Each recovery worker will hold a small caseload. Working as one integrated team, the Recovery and Outreach sub-contracted element of the model enhances outreach, particularly out of hours and at weekends, and plays a critical role in building relationships, improving engagement, and reconnecting individuals with clinical care where appropriate.
